Output d881863a3f9b441783e80e5ec9205d1aeaedb61bab9037e8e63df216cd4f7270:374

value
33429412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75da7e14a983df28e003ff4a464bafab3bc426ac OP_EQUAL
address
MJeK2zvrLtRDmi83stsT1xxBbn1h9fFnZp
transaction
d881863a3f9b441783e80e5ec9205d1aeaedb61bab9037e8e63df216cd4f7270
spent
true